Edition #342
Situation generally screwed up
Act 1: New financial fight - Rachel Maddow
Act 2: Scott Patterson on The Quants - Daily Show
Act 3: Politicians admit they're owned by Wall Street - Young Turks
Act 4: Is the economic ship sinking and rats jumping ship - Thom Hartmann
Act 5: Elizabeth Warren interview - Real time with Bill Maher
Act 6: Elizabeth Warren interview - Daily Show
Act 7: Teeing off on Fareed Zakaria - Citizen Radio
Bonus iPhone/iPod Touch App Content:
Has Obama just become a Herbert Hoover Republican? - Thom Hartmann
